The capability to manage a child’s Apple iPhone restrictions using a device operating on the Android platform addresses a growing need in households utilizing both iOS and Android ecosystems. It encompasses features such as screen time limitations, content filtering, purchase approvals, and location tracking, all accessible and configurable from an Android smartphone or tablet. For instance, a parent with an Android phone can set daily time limits for games on their child’s iPhone or block access to specific websites deemed inappropriate, all without needing an Apple device.
The importance of this functionality lies in its convenience and inclusivity. It removes the barrier of requiring Apple-specific hardware for parental oversight of iOS devices, offering families more flexibility. Historically, managing Apple device settings mandated the use of another Apple product. The introduction of cross-platform solutions expands access to crucial digital safety tools for a broader audience, enabling parents to proactively manage their child’s online experiences and digital well-being, regardless of their preferred operating system.
